12 Volts     white (common 40A)     +     relay holder behind dash fuse box, white 44 pin plug, pin 29
Second 12 Volts     white (common 40A)     +     fuse holder R of dash FB, white 20 pin plug, pin 8
Starter     BLACK/ white     +     relay holder behind dash fuse box, white 44 pin plug, pin 2
Second Starter     BLACK/ white (SS1); BLACK/ orange (SS2)     -     push button ignition switch, white 14 pin plug, pins 7, 2
Ignition     green     +     dash fuse box, rear, brown 9 pin plug, pin 8
Second Ignition     blue     +     dash fuse box, rear, brown 9 pin plug, pin 3
Third Ignition     N/A  
Accessory     blue / YELLOW     +     dash fuse box, rear, brown 9 pin plug, pin 7
Second Accessory     N/A  
Third Accessory     N/A  
Keysense     N/A  
Data Bus     RED / yellow (immobilizer serial communication)     data     ECM behind glove box, white 35 pin plug (B), pin 25
Can Bus High     red     data     data link connector, black 16 pin plug, pin 6
Can Bus Low     blue     data     data link connector, black 16 pin plug pin 14
Can Bus Sw     red (keyless entry serial communication)     data     driver kick, white 20 pin plug, pin 8
Power Lock     lt. GREEN/ black     -     driver kick, white 28 pin plug, pin 15
Power Unlock     blue/black     -     driver kick, white 28 pin plug, pin 16
Lock Motor     RED / green     5 wire     driver kick, white 28 pin plug, pin 17
Driver Unlock Motor     lt. green     5 wire     driver kick, white 28 pin plug, pin 18
Passenger Unlock Motor     lt. green     5 wire     driver kick, white 24 pin plug, pin 13
Parking Lights (-)     BLACK/ blue     -     headlight switch, white 20 pin plug, pin 18
Parking Lights (+)     BLACK/ white     +     dash fuse box, white 20 pin plug, pin 12
Hazards     green     -     left of steering column, white 17 pin plug, pin 10
Turn Signal (Left)     WHITE/ red     +     dash fuse box, white 20 pin plug, pin 20
Turn Signal (Right)     gray     +     dash fuse box, white 20 pin plug, pin 3
Headlight     blue/black     -     headlight switch, white 20 pin plug, pin 20
AutoLights     blue/orange (interrupt to turn off autolights)     -     headlight switch, white 20 pin plug, pin 19
Reverse Light     BROWN / yellow     +     passenger kick, white 20 pin plug, pin 4
Left Front Door Trigger     blue/orange to blue/white     -     driver kick, white 10 pin plug, pin 8
Right Front Door Trigger     blue/orange     -     BIU behind dash fuse box, black 35 pin plg, pin 13
Left Rear Door Trigger     yellow/white     -     driver kick, white 10 pin plug, pin 9
Right Rear Door Trigger     WHITE/ red     -     BIU behind dash fuse box, black 35 pin plg, pin 25
Dome Supervision     GREEN/  YELLOW     -     left of steering column, white 12 pin plug, pin 9
Trunk/Hatch Pin     yellow/blue     -     BIU behind dash fuse box, black 35 pin plug, pin 33
Rear Glass Pin     N/A  
Hood Pin     yellow/black (with remote start only)     -     Remote Start Module conn above brake pedal, wht 8 pin plug, pin 5
Trunk/Hatch Release     GREEN/ red (rear handle switch)     -     BIU behind dash fuse box, black 35 pin plug, pin 10
Trunk Release Motor     BLACK/ blue     5 wire     BIU behind dash fuse box, white 31 pin plug, pin 7
Fuel Door Release     N/A  
Power Sliding Door (Left)     N/A  
Power Sliding Door (Right)     N/A  
Factory Alarm Arm     (arms on lock with driver door open)  
Factory Alarm Disarm     (see disarm no unlock)  
Disarm No Unlock     (smart key and ignition)  
Trunk Alarm Shunt     N/A  
Tachometer     green     ac     Keyless Access Module right of BIU, white 18 pin plug, pin 17
Wait to Start     N/A  
Neutral Safety     GREEN/ black (M/T)     -     ECM behind glove box, white 35 pin plug (C), pin 35
Clutch Pedal     lt. green     +     clutch switch, white 2 pin plug, pin 2
Fuel Pump     RED / black     +     passenger kick, white 20 pin plug, pin 5
Rear Defroster     PURPLE / green     - latched     BIU behind dash fuse box, white 34 pin plug, pin 26
Mirror Defroster     (mirror same as rear defrost); blue (wiper deicer)     - latched     BIU behind dash fuse box, white 31 pin plug, pin 9
Left Front Heated Seat     RED / white (LO); white (HI)     5 wire     seat heater switch, white 8 pin plug, pins 3, 8
Right Front Heated Seat     RED / blue (LO); lt. green (HI)     5 wire     seat heater switch, white 8 pin plug, pins 1, 4
Speed Sense     pink/green (some models only)     ac     radio, white 20 pin plug, pin 19, or white 28 pin plug, pin 17
Brake Wire     brown     +     dash fuse box, white 20 pin plug, pin 15
Parking Brake     gray     -     driver kick, white 24 pin plug, pin 16
Horn Trigger     red     -     horn switch, white 14 pin plug, pin 9
Wipers     RED / blue (LO); BLACK/ blue (HI); GREEN/ black (ign)     +     wiper switch, white 10 pin plug, pins 3, 4, 2
Left Front Window (Up/Down)     blue/red - blue/green     A     power window main switch, white 16 pin plug, pins 16 - 13
Right Front Window (Up/Down)     red - RED / yellow     A     driver kick, white 28 pin plug, pins 5 - 6
Left Rear Window (Up/Down)     GREEN/ red - BLACK / YELLOW     A     driver kick, white 28 pin plug, pins 9 - 10
Right Rear Window (Up/Down)     blue - blue / YELLOW     A     driver kick, white 28 pin plug, pins 7 - 8
Sun Roof (Open/Close)     blue - red (function with ignition on only)     +     sunroof switch, white 5 pin plug, pins 1 - 4
Sun Roof (Limit/Close)     N/A  
Memory Seat 1     N/A  
Memory Seat 2     N/A  
Memory Seat 3     N/A  
Radio 12V     blue/red     +     radio, white 20 pin plug, pin 20, or white 10 pin plug, pin 4
Radio Ground     BLACK/ blue     -     radio, white 20 pin plug, pin 10, or white 10 pin plug, pin 7
Radio Ignition     yellow/red     +     radio, white 20 pin plug, pin 3, or white 10 pin plug, pin 3
Radio Illumination     purple (parking lights); BLACK/ white (dimmer)     +,-     radio, white 20 pin plug, pins 1, 2
On models with navigation, they are in the white 10 pin plug, pin 10, and white 6 pin plug, pin 5.
Factory Amp Turn-on     N/A  
Power Antenna     yellow/black     +     radio, white 20 pin plug, pin 9, or white 10 pin plug, pin 8
Left Front Speaker (+/-)     WHITE/ black - blue/orange     +,-     radio, white 20 pin plug, pins 7 - 8, or white 10 pin plug, pins 6 - 2
Right Front Speaker (+/-)     green - BROWN / yellow     +,-     radio, white 20 pin plug, pins 17 - 18, or white 10 pin plug, pins 5 - 1
Left Rear Speaker (+/-)     RED / black - WHITE/ red     +,-     radio, white 20 pin plug, pins 5 - 6, or white 6 pin plug, pins 6 - 2
Right Rear Speaker (+/-)     RED / white - gray/green     +,-     radio, white 20 pin plug, pins 15 - 16, or white 6 pin plug, pins 3 - 1
Center Channel (+/-)     N/A  
Subwoofer (+/-)     N/A  
Aux. Audio Input Left (+/-)     white - (shield)     +,-     radio, 16P plug, pins 3-11 or 28P plug, pins 28-27
Aux. Audio Input Right (+/-)     black - (shield)     +,-     radio, 16P plug, pins 4-11 or 28P plug, pins 26-27
RSE Video (+/-)     red - gray/blue     +,-     radio, 4 pin plug
RSE Audio Left (+/-)     N/A  
RSE Audio Right (+/-)     N/A  
Satellite Radio 12 Volts     (built into radio)  
Satellite Radio Ground     N/A  
Satellite Radio Ignition     N/A  
Satellite Radio Antenna     N/A  
Satellite Audio Left (+/-)     N/A  
Satellite Audio Right (+/-)     N/A  
Item     Size     Depth     Location
Headunit     double DIN  center of dash
Left Front Speaker     6.3  left front door
Left Front Tweeter     2.56  left front dash
Right Front Speaker     6.3  right front door
Right Front Tweeter     2.56  right front dash
Left Rear Speaker     6.3  left rear door
Left Rear Tweeter     N/A  
Right Rear Speaker     6.3  right rear door
Right Rear Tweeter     N/A  
Center Channel     N/A  
Subwoofer     N/A  
Bypass module 
idatalink ads al ca gives you door locks and bypass and should come pre programmed.  I do not see a module available from directed. 
Or an ego-all by fortin would also work for door locks and bypass. 
Gary Sather